What is a sales purchasing professional?

A Sales Purchasing professional is responsible for managing both the procurement of products or materials and the facilitation of sales activities within an organization. Their duties often include sourcing suppliers, negotiating prices, placing orders, maintaining inventory levels, and coordinating sales strategies to meet customer demands. This role requires strong negotiation, communication, and analytical skills to balance cost-effectiveness and customer satisfaction. Sales Purchasing professionals work closely with vendors, sales teams, and other departments to ensure smooth operations and optimal profitability.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a sales purchasing professional?

To thrive as a Sales Purchasing professional, you need strong negotiation skills, a solid understanding of supply chain processes, and typically a background in business or procurement. Familiarity with procurement software (like SAP or Oracle), inventory management systems, and relevant certifications (such as CPSM) is highly beneficial. Excellent communication, relationship-building, and analytical thinking are crucial soft skills for success in this role. These skills ensure effective supplier management, optimized purchasing decisions, and seamless collaboration with sales teams, all of which drive organizational profitability and efficiency.

How do sales purchasing professionals typically coll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th procurement processes?

Sales Purchasing professionals work closely with departments such as inventory management, finance, and sales to ensure that procurement aligns with both client needs and organizational budgets. They often coordinate with sales teams to forecast demand, negotiate with suppliers for favorable terms, and ensure timely delivery of goods. Regular meetings and clear communication with cross-functional teams are common practices, helping to address any supply chain issues swiftly and maintain strong relationships both internally and externally.

Is sales purchasing a stressful job?

Sales purchasing can be stressful due to the need to meet tight deadlines, manage supplier relationships, and ensure cost efficiency. The role often requires strong organizational skills and the ability to handle pressure, especially during high-demand periods or supply chain disruptions.

Legends Global, a leader in privately managed public assembly facilities, has an excellent and immediate opening for a Purchasing Analyst at the Moscone Center.

POSITION SUMMARY

Serves as the liaison between Sales, Culinary, and Purchasing teams. Responsible for sourcing new vendors, products, and ingredients; determining recipe costing provided by Culinary; maintaining items and recipes within F&B inventory management systems; and supporting the Purchasing Director as needed.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Include, but are not limited to:

  • Issues, receives, properly stores, and maintains control of all food & beverage products and inventory.

  • Creates issue and transfer requisitions for products moving between kitchen, warehouse, and operations, including returns.

  • Alerts Purchasing Management regarding:

    • Post-event overstock requiring vendor return

    • Daily shortages, substitutions, and product returns

  • Communicates changes in market conditions, pricing, seasonality, and product availability to the Purchasing Director.

Cross-Department Collaboration (Sales, Purchasing, Retail, Culinary)
  • Sources new vendors, products and ingredients upon request.

  • Provides cost, lead times, minimum order quantities, and relevant sourcing details.

  • Obtains samples for management review.

  • Works with Culinary to obtain recipes for costing analysis.

  • Identifies and evaluates new vendors when needed, ensuring:

    • Accurate initial pricing

    • Completion and submission of credit applications, W-9s, and required accounting documentation prior to ordering

Inventory & Systems Management
  • Tracks "food miles" for designated events, documenting sourcing distance to delivery.

  • Maintains inventory and recipe data within CBORD or EATEC systems, including:

    • Updating item costs and units of measure

    • Creating and maintaining vendor and product records

    • Ensuring data integrity across recipes and inventory items

  • Records all purchases from invoices into CBORD/EATEC and reconciles purchase orders to invoices.

  • Coordinates invoice coding, approvals, and daily submission to Accounting.

  • Prepares daily, monthly, and pre/post-event inventories and ensures accuracy.

  • Performs monthly inventory counts and provides variance analysis and cost explanations.

ASM Global was formed in October 2019 from the merger of AEG Facilities, the global innovator in live entertainment venues, and SMG, the gold standard in event management. ASM Global is a venue management powerhouse that spans five continents, 14 countries and more than 300 of the world's most prestigious arenas, stadiums, convention and exhibit centers, and performing arts venues. As the world's most trusted venue manager, ASM Global provides venue strategy and management, sales, marketing, event booking and programming, construction and design consulting, and pre-opening services. Among the venues in our portfolio are landmark facilities such as McCormick Place & Soldier Field in Chicago, the Los Angeles Convention Center, Tele2 Arena in Stockholm, the Mercedes-Benz Superdome in New Orleans, the Shenzhen World Exhibition and Conference Centre in Shenzhen, China and Van Andel Arena, DeVos Place & DeVos Performance Hall in Grand Rapids, Michigan. ASM Global also offers food and beverage operations through its concessions and catering companies.
